Summary
Mr. Jean-Yves Bony draws the attention of the Minister of the Economy and Finance to the conditions mentioned several times by the Government for the application of the increase in taxation on cigarette packets (40% increase). It is clear that although this increase meets a strong health objective, it nonetheless requires the implementation of an effective plan to combat smuggling and real support for the profession. However, the trafficking of tobacco products at cut-rate prices on French soil is booming and creates an effect of unfair competition towards tobacconists, an essential cog in maintaining social ties in our rural territories. Smuggling is also particularly worrying in cross-border areas and European harmonization is getting bogged down. The Government has affirmed its desire to fight against these traffics. He would like to know the measures he intends to take to require border countries to impose identical taxation on their packets of cigarettes and to wage an effective fight against trafficking linked to tobacco products, particularly in cross-border areas.
